I still like the game and gamble on a frequent basis. Over the years I have gambled on a type of blackjack called "The Take it Leave it Method". You will not get rich with this tactic or beat the casino, nonetheless you will have a lot of fun. This tactic is based on the idea that 21 seems to be a game of streaks. When you are hot your hot, and when you’re not you are NOT!

I play basic strategy chemin de fer. When I don’t win I wager the lowest amount allowed on the next hand. If I do not win again I wager the lowest amount allowed on the next hand again etc. Once I win I take the winnings paid to me and I bet the original bet again. If I win this hand I then keep in play the winnings paid to me and now have double my original bet on the table. If I succeed again I take the payout paid to me, and if I succeed the next hand I leave it for a total of 4 times my original bet. I continue wagering this way "Take it Leave it etc". Once I lose I return the wager back down to the original value.

I am very strict and never back out. It gets very fun at times. If you succeed at a few hands in series your bets go up very quick. Before you know it you are wagering $100-200/ hand. I have had great streaks a couple of times now. I left a $5 table at the MGM a number of years ago with $750 after 30 mins using this tactic! And a number of weeks ago in Atlantic City I left a game with $1200!

You need to comprehend that you can lose much faster this way too!. But it really makes the game more thrilling. And you will be astonished at the runs you see wagering this way. Here is a chart of what you would wager if you continue winning at a 5 dollar table.
